  • Page 28: Ignition & Usage

    IGNITION & USAGE Note: Summary ignition instructions are posted on the cart leg under the control knobs. Note : The ignition system ignites the burners with a spark from the igniter electrode inside the ignition chamber. You generate the energy for the spark by pushing the ignition button until it clicks.

  • Page 34: Push-Button Ignition System Operations (Q300)

    MAINTENANCE If the push-button ignition system fails to ignite, be sure there is gas flow by attempting to match light your burners. Refer to “MANUAL IGNITION.” If match lighting is successful, the problem lies in the ignition system. ® If the electronic ignition system fails to ignite, be sure there is gas flow by attempting to match light your burners.
